Public RelationsSiemens posts Q4 net loss of euro 1.06 bn
German engineering conglomerate Siemens today said its net loss was at euro 1.06 billion (about $1.5 billion) in the fourth quarter of this year.

Siemens said, it posted a net loss of euro 1.06 billion in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2008-09, primarily due to a non-cash loss of euro 1.96 billion from the group"s Nokia Siemens Network unit.
In the year-ago period, the company had a net loss of euro 2.42 billion, Siemens said in a statement.
Nokia Siemens, is a 50-50 joint venture of Finnish telecom equipment maker Nokia and Siemens AG.
The company said revenue at euro 19.71 billion was down 9 per cent in the fourth quarter this year compared to the prior-year quarter.
For fiscal 2009, total profit rose to euro 7.46 billion, and income from continuing operations increased to euro 2.45 billion.
